"Actuarial Receivable" means any Receivable under which the portion of a payment allocable to interest and the portion of a payment allocable to principal is determined in accordance with the "actuarial" method. "Adjusted APR" means the APR reduced by the annualized rate corresponding to any Monthly Dealer Participation Fee. "Affiliate" of any Person means any Person who directly or indirectly controls, is controlled by, or is under direct or indirect common control with such Person. For purposes of this definition of "Affiliate", the term "control" (including the terms "controlling", "controlled by" and "under common control with") means the possession, directly or indirectly, of the power to direct or cause a direction of the management and policies of a Person, whether through the ownership of voting securities, by contract or otherwise. "Rule of 78's Receivable" means any Receivable under which the portion of a payment allocable to earned interest (which may be referred to in the related retail installment sale contract as an add-on finance charge) and the portion allocable to the Amount Financed is determined according to the method commonly referred to as the "Rule of 78's" method, the "sum of periodic balances" method, the "sum of monthly balances" method or any equivalent method. "Simple Interest Method" means the method of allocating a fixed level payment between principal and interest, pursuant to which the portion of such payment that is allocated to interest is equal to the product of the APR multiplied by the unpaid principal balance multiplied by the period of time (expressed as a fraction of a year, based on the actual number of days in the calendar month and the actual number of days in the calendar year) elapsed since the preceding payment of interest was made and the remainder of such payment is allocable to principal. 27 "Simple Interest Receivable" means any Receivable under which the portion of a payment allocable to interest and the portion allocable to principal is determined in accordance with the Simple Interest Method.
